Just 3 days after an upset loss to Vanderbilt in the SEC womens tournament the lady tigers hoops program suffered an even bigger upset today. Head Coach Pokey Chatman announced that she is stepping down as head coach effective the end of her current contract on april 30th of this year. She made the announcement in a statement released this afternoon,saying she is leaving the program to pursue other professional opportunities, no word as to what that will entail. But it will be hard to surpass the success she has had with the lady tigers. In her two seasons, LSU has advanced to two NCAA final fours, won two SEC regular season titles and earned a no. 1 seed in each of the last two NCAA tournaments. She also said she planned on coaching the team throughout the ncaa tournament.
